The role:

As the Traffic Marshall for the development, you will be responsible for:

  1. Working under the supervision and management of the Project Manager, Site Manager, and Assistant Site Manager.
  2. Ensuring contractors are parking as per the site safety policy.
  3. Controlling the flow of traffic when deliveries enter the site.
  4. Securing barrier protection around the site and making sure the fencing is secure.

Please note there are no welfare responsibilities involved in this role.
